Got a Burst Pipe? Turn Off Your Main Water Valve
You have to understand how to switch off your primary water line if you struggle with a ruptured pipe. Do not wait on a plumbing emergency prior to discovering just how to get this done. Besides, other than emergency leakages, you will certainly need to shut off your major water shutoff for plumbing repairs or if you leave for a long trip. Why Must You Shut the Main Line Off?


Familiarizing yourself with exactly how your mainline switches on as well as off can conserve you throughout an emergency. For instance, when a pipeline unexpectedly bursts in your house, you'll be besieged with panic. Therefore, you can easily shut the valve off and prevent a lot more damages if you understand what to do. Furthermore, shutting this off assures you do not need to manage a sudden flood in your house.
In addition to that, shutting and also opening up the valves every so often guarantees they don't get stuck. It is also the very best time for you to check for rust or other damaged connections. Moreover, make it an indicate educate various other family members on what to do. This makes normal maintenance as well as handling emergency situations a lot simpler. Where is This Key Shutoff Located?


The primary water line supply can differ, so you might need to discover time to find out where it is. Unfortunately, when your house is getting soaked due to a ruptured pipeline, you do not have the luxury of time during an emergency. Thus, you should get ready for this plumbing dilemma by finding out where the valve is located.
This shutoff valve could look like a ball valve (with a lever-type handle) or a gate valve (with a circle faucet). Positioning depends upon the age of your home as well as the climate in your location. Check the following typical places:
  • Inside of House: In chillier climates, the city supply pipes encounter your residence. Inspect common energy areas like your basement, utility room, or garage. A likely area is near the hot water heater. In the basement, this shutoff will go to your eye level. On the various other primary floors, you might require to bend down to discover it.

  • Outdoors on the Outside Wall: The major valve is outside the home in exotic climates where they do not experience winter. It is usually linked to an outside wall. Check for it near an exterior faucet.

  • Outdoors by the Street: If you can not locate the valve anywhere else, it is time to inspect your road. It could be outside beside your water meter. Maybe listed below the access panel near the ground on your street. You may require a meter trick that's marketed in hardware stores to take off the panel cover. You can discover two shutoffs, one for city usage and also one for your residence. Make sure you shut off the right one. And you will know that you did when none of the taps in your home release freshwater.

  • Must This Always Be Shut Off?


    Apart from emergency situations, fixings, or long trips, you might not require to shut off the main shutoff. As an example, so one fixture has concerns, you can turn off the branch shutoff because spot. In this manner, you can still utilize water in various other parts of the house.     What to Do When a Pipe Bursts in Your Home


    A burst pipe is one of a homeowner's worst nightmares. Not knowing the signs and being unprepared for this plumbing issue can result in more water damage and clean up. Here are the warning signs of a pipe about to burst and the steps you can take if it happens.


    Warning Signs for Burst Pipes


  • Rusty, discolored water with a bad smell


  • Puddles under your sinks


  • Abrupt changes in water pressure


  • A spike in your water bill


  • Clanging noises coming from pipes behind the walls


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ts


    Turn off your water. The sooner you do this, the better. Shutting off your main valve will help minimize the damage to your home.



    Drain the faucets. After the water has been turned off, drain the remaining water by opening your faucets. Doing so will help prevent areas from freezing and also relieve pressure within your pipe system to avoid more bursts.



    Locate the burst pipe. Look for bulging ceilings, warping and other signs of where the water damage has occurred. Once you locate the pipe, you will be able to determine if it is a small crack that can be patched or a major repair that needs to be dealt with right away.

    Document the damage. If you have extensive pipe damage, be sure to take photos of the affected areas so you can document a claim with your insurance. Take close-up photos of the damage and use a measuring tape to show how high the water is. You should also take photos from different angles for a wider picture of the affected areas.



    Start cleaning. After you have documented the damage, start cleaning up the water as soon as possible. The longer the water sits, the higher the chance that mold will develop.
